What happens when there are too many managers in a company?

When the tooth-to-tail the ratio becomes too low, front-line people have to send every customer request or idea for improvement up through the bureaucracy and wait days or weeks for a response. That creates long delays for customers; and makes employees feel disempowered. A second likely culprit is too many supervisory layers.

Can a bad manager make you leave your job?

In their “The State of the American Manager” study, Gallup found that half (50%) of all Americans have left a job to “get away from their manager at some point in their career.” We’ve said it before, but it begs repeating: employees leave managers, not companies. And a bad manager can make employees leave in waves.

Is it bad to not want to be a manager?

Not everyone wants to spend their days helping fix people issues, listening to the problems of others, and developing people. If they’re not excited to do those things, they probably shouldn’t be a manager. This one is particularly damaging to team members.
